Transaction 8482ca68934b22967382445bce5ee1126a60f7afae4b053b3e430086fbca15e4

1 Input
2 Outputs
  • 8482ca68934b22967382445bce5ee1126a60f7afae4b053b3e430086fbca15e4:0
  • value  126898
    address  1FCCTdqHiMRYQxgf93aisiEUmDsj3hjMHz
  • 8482ca68934b22967382445bce5ee1126a60f7afae4b053b3e430086fbca15e4:1
  • value  31906127
    address  3C5UU6opG1shMeteN76oF71J5YjtbWMtEZ